graffito the poetry poster

Susan Helwig meets Dr. Suess: “I’ll lift my skirt for you, babe,/I’ll do anything you see,/to make sure your next love song/will be written about me.” P.J. Meneilly meets Elvis: “why don’t you give me a kiss,” said the boy with the ducktail/and I almost leaned across my husband,/his wife,/his band,/the beer/and licked the sweat off his cheek. Ted Plantos meets Ted Plantos. graffito has something for everyone. There are poems here for people who like rhymes, poems for people who like nature, poems for people who hate nature, poems for people who hate poems; and all of it on a single 11 x 17 poster. One every month. Every month a different colour. With bonus reviews and editorials on the back.
